A request for English-Irish street signage at Woodside Hill, Portadown, has finally been approved. Woodside Hill had been the first street in the Armagh City, Banbridge & Craigavon Borough Council area to meet the criteria for such provision – namely two thirds of residents in favour of bilingual signs.
